PE-ALD를 이용한 SnO<sub>2</sub> Thin Film의 특성
박용주,이운영,최용국,이현규,박진성,Park Yongju,Lee Woonyoung,Choi Yongkook,Lee Hyunkyu,Park Jinseong 한국재료학회 2004 한국재료학회지 Vol.14 No.12
Tin dioxide ($SnO_2$) thin films were prepared on Si(100) substrate by PE-ALD using the $DBDTA((CH_{3}CO_2)_{2}Sn[(CH_2)_{3}CH_3]_2)$ Precursor. The properties were studied as a function of source temperature, substrate temperature, and purging time. Scanning probe microscopic images at the source temperature $50^{\circ}C$ and the substrate temperature $300^{\circ}C$ shows lower roughness than those $40/60^{\circ}C$ source and $200/400^{\circ}C$ substrate temperature samples. The purging time for optimum process was 8sec and the deposition rate was about 1 nm per 10 cycles. The conductance of $SnO_2$ thin film showed a constant region in the range of $200^{\circ}C\;to\;500^{\circ}C$. The thin films deposited for 200 cycle show a better sensitivity to CO gas.
생체 환경 정보 센싱 모듈 및 농장 제어 게이트웨이를 이용한 스마트 낙농 관리 시스템 개발
박용주,문준,Park, Yongju,Moon, Jun 대한임베디드공학회 2016 대한임베디드공학회논문지 Vol.11 No.1
Recently, the u-IT applications for plants and livestock become larger and control of livestock farm environment has been used important in the field of industry. We implemented wireless sensor networks and farm environment automatic control system for applying to the breeding barn environment by calculating the THI index. First, we gathered environmental information like livestock object temperature, heart rate and momentum. And we also collected the farm environment data including temperature, humidity and illuminance for calculating the THI index. Then we provide accurate control action roof open and electric fan in of intelligent farm to keep the best state automatically by using collected data. We believed this technology can improve industrial competitiveness through the u-IT based smart integrated management system introduction for industry aversion and dairy industries labor shortages due to hard work and old ageing.
충전율의 변화가 밀폐형 2-상 열사이폰의 열전달 특성에 미치는 영향에 관한 연구
박용주,홍성은,김철주,Park, Yong-Joo,Hong, Sung-Eun,Kim, Chul-Ju 대한기계학회 2002 大韓機械學會論文集B Vol.26 No.12
A two-phase closed thermosyphon was one of the most effective devices in the removing heat because of its simple structure, thermal diode characteristics, wide operating temperature range and so on. In this study, a two-phase closed thermosyphon(working fluid PFC(C6F14), container copper(inner grooved surface)) was fabricated with a reservoir which can change the fill charge ratio. The experiments were performed in the range of 50~600W heat flow rate and 10~70% fill charge ratio. The results were compared with some correlations that were presented by Rohsenow and Immura et al. in the evaporator, by Nusselt, Gross and Uehara et al. in the condenser and by Cohen and Bayley, Wallis, Kutateladze and Faghri et al. in heat transfer limitation etc.. The heat transfer coefficient at the evaporator increased with the input power. However the effect of the fill charge ratio was nearly negligible. At the condenser, it showed an opposite trend to the evaporator and with increase of the fill charge ratio, showed some enhancement of heat transfer. The heat transport limitation was occurred by the dry-out limitation for small fill charge ratio(10%) and presented about 100W. For the case of large fill charge ratio(Ψ$\geq$40%), it was occurred by the flooding limitation at about 500W.
홍바리(Epinephelus fasciatus) FSHβ와 LHβsubunit의 분리 및 동정
박용주 ( Yong Ju Park ),강형철 ( Hyeong Cheol Kang ),이치훈 ( Chi Hoon Lee ),송영보 ( Young Bo Song ),백혜자 ( Hea Ja Baek ),김형배 ( Hyung Bae Kim ),( Kiyoshi Soyano ),이영돈 ( Young Don Lee ) 한국수산과학회(구 한국수산학회) 2012 한국수산과학회지 Vol.45 No.1
We cloned and sequenced the cDNA encoding the FSHβ and LHβ subunits from the pituitary of the blacktip grouper Epinephelus fasciatus, which regulate vitellogenesis and maturation in vertebrates, to achieve stable and healthy gametes. The full-length cDNAs of FSHβ and LHβ were 571 bp and 617 bp, encoding 120 amino acid (aa) and 147 aa proteins, respectively. The deduced amino acid sequences of FSHβ and LHβ were highly homologous (68-97%) to those of other Perciformes; E. bruneus, Dicentrarchus labrax, Thunnus thynnus, and Pseudolabrus sieboldi. Phylogenetic analysis showed that the deduced FSHβ and LHβ amino acid sequences were categorized as a distinct subunit in the GTHβ family, and are closely related to the teleostei FSHβ and LHβ, respectively. FSHβ and LHβ mRNA exhibited high abundance in the pituitary gland and low in other brain areas, but were not present in peripheral tissues, as determined by RT-PCR.
상부 소화관 출혈에 대한 HSE 국주에 의한 내시경적 지혈성적에 대한 고찰
박용주 ( Park Yong Ju ),김영철 ( Kim Yeong Cheol ),홍득민 ( Hong Deug Min ),김두섭 ( Kim Du Seob ),윤중근 ( Yun Jung Geun ),이성주 ( Lee Seong Ju ) 대한내과학회 1992 대한내과학회지 Vol.42 No.4
N/A Abstract Background: Hemostasis of upper gastrointestinal bleeding had been tried by various method. Method : Two-hundred-and-eight patients with upper gastrointestinal hemorrhage were treated by endoscopic local injection of hypertonic saline-epinephrine (HSE) solution at our hospital during the 2-year period from February 1989 to January 1991. Result : The 208 cases included 115 gastric ulcers, 36 duodenal ulcers, 28 stomach cancers, 14 Mallory-weiss syndromes, 13 marginal ulers, and other diagnosis. A total of 45 cases (21.6%) had serious systemic diseases such as decompensatory liver cirrhosis, postoperative bleeding, malignant tumors of other organ, cerebrovascular disease and renal failure. In cases without serious systemic disease, permanent and temporary hemostasis were demonstrated in 98.8% and 1.2% respectively. In cases with serious systemic disease, permanent and temporary hemostsis were demonstrated in 68.9% and 17.8% respectively. An apparent hemostatic effect was not evident in 13.3%. Conclusion : Local injection of HSE solution can be repeated in large does and applied for various types of hemorrhage, producing excellent hemostasis.
